Following the expansion of Feldmark-based sourcing, we will hedge sixty percent of projected foreign-currency exposure for the next four quarters using forward contracts. The remaining exposure stays unhedged to preserve upside if the crown weakens further. Department forecasts should be submitted in local currency; Treasury will apply the hedge rates centrally. Costs of the program are charged to the corporate line, not departmental budgets. One sensitive point follows for your awareness only.

board note of bawep-tajef: Queniusek Systems plans to raise the Quenvan list price by 53.1 percent in March. The pricing group signed off on a budget of $176.4 million for Project Drueth. The renewal with Casionix Partners closes at $142.5 million a year, 8.3 percent below the last contract. Project Fraax slips by six weeks because of the tooling delay.

☐ Off-site run — Penlow Archive film reels

Collect the six sealed canisters of nitrate-era reels from the cold store at Grathen House no later than 09:30. Canisters must remain upright, strapped, and out of direct sunlight for the entire drive; cabin temperature should stay below twenty degrees. The archive registrar will verify canister numbers against the transfer sheet on arrival. The following instruction applies to the hand-over and must not be shared further.

courier memo of bajop-kagep: the norwyn wenath courier leaves the keliel jorath wenmir ledger at gate 9298 under passcode 241279

**Ticket: Stale comparisons in Farebeam parity checker**

The Farebeam rate-parity checker is comparing cached channel prices against live direct rates, so hotels on the Quillmont pilot see false parity violations after any midday price change. Root cause is a cache key that omits the rate-plan revision. The fix invalidates cache entries on revision bump and adds a freshness guard. Requesting inclusion in this week's release train; regression suite passes. The patched build reference appears below.

trace token, fafog-kageg: htk4_98e6

Deep links on Fernpath route through the IntentBridge module before hitting the navigator. Verify that any new path pattern is registered in both the manifest and the universal-link map, and that fallback routing lands on the home screen. When testing on staging devices, reference the build token printed below.

pipeline stamp: htk3_a71